26.01.2012

In Norway, there are two national DAB multiplexes on air, one of which is split into seven regional muxes.

There are nine audio and one data services on the national multiplex. These are a mix of stations from the public broadcaster NRK and commercial radio operators.

At certain points during the day, the seven regional multiplexes broadcast local services from NRK P1as well as some niche programming such as classical and folk music.

In total the DAB networks offer 20 channels with 7 commercial and 13 public. with 2 additional ones available in central Oslo only (DAB+). All major FM radio channels in Norway are also available via DAB.

One student radio station, Nova, also has temporary licence to broadcast in the Oslo central area on DAB+.
